Indiana Code § 12-17.6-8-2

Right to appeal

Sec. 2. An applicant for or a recipient of services under the program may appeal to the office if at least one (1) of the following occurs: (1) An application or a request is not acted upon by the office within a reasonable time after the application or request is filed. (2) The application is denied. (3) The applicant or recipient is dissatisfied with the action of the office.
